Text of the Opening Remarks by the Chairman at the 261st Session of Rajya Sabha

Posted On: 18 SEP 2023 12:58PM by PIB Delhi

Hon'ble Members, at the outset, I extend warm greetings to you on the beginning of the 261st Session of Rajya Sabha.

Hon’ble Members, this session makes available a befitting opportunity to reflect and introspect on “PARLIAMENTARY JOURNEY of 75 YEARS STARTING FROM SAMVIDHAN SABHA – ACHIEVEMENTS, EXPERIENCES, MEMORIES AND LEARNINGS”. 

Traversing over seven-decade journey, from Samvidhan Sabha to the present day in Amrit Kaal, these hallowed precincts have witnessed many milestones.

Hon’ble Members this journey had historical moments- from ‘Tryst with Destiny’ at Midnight of 15th August, 1947 to unfolding of innovative forwarding looking GST regime at midnight of June, 30, 2017 and now this day. 

Deliberations in the Constituent Assembly in various sessions spread over three years exemplified decorum and healthy debate.  Contentious and highly divisive issues were negotiated in a spirit of consensus. There is enough takeaway from this for us all.

Healthy debate is hallmark of a blossoming democracy. We must eschew confrontational posturing.  Weaponising disruption and disturbance as strategy would never secure sanction of the people.  We all are constitutionally ordained to nurture democratic values and must so justify and vindicate the trust of the people

We owe it to the nation to optimally utilise the opportunity and time to subserve public interest.

Hon'ble Members, this is also an occasion to recall and glorify:

•Our tenacious freedom fighters. They were the pioneers in true sense to fight for democratic rights;

•Our erudite constitutional forefathers - they were farsighted visionaries who, after much deliberations and discussions provided us a Constitution which has stood the test of the time;

•Our statesmen and politicians have time and again respected and abided by constitutional ideals and have democratised the Constitution itself by taking its essence to the masses;

•The Civil Service- the bureaucrats who have been steadfast day in and day out in ensuring that the state machinery works in a free and fair manner

•And finally it is the masses whose deep faith and unflinching belief in the parliamentary democracy sustained it and thwarted the worst possible attempt to deny democratic values.

The success of our democracy, is thus, a collective concerted endeavour of “WE THE PEOPLE OF INDIA”.

Expectedly the Hon’ble Members, during the course of the day, would enrich the House and enlighten the people at large as regards our 75-year journey and unfold vision for years ahead.

Hon’ble Members use of wit, humour, sarcasm and even acerbic comments inside Parliament are important inalienable facet of a vigorous democracy.  These days we don’t get to hear such light hearted exchanges. Hopefully we’ll see the revival of wit, humour and scholarly debates.

The hallowed precincts of Parliament for years have witnessed highs and lows which we need to reflect and deliberate so as to take our Bharat to its rightful place in 2047 when it celebrates centenary of independence. 

I now invite the Hon’ble Leader of the House Shri Piyush Goyal to initiate the Discussion on “Parliamentary Journey of 75 years starting from Samvidhan Sabha – Achievements, Experiences, Memories and Learnings”.
